Sunrun: APS Move Away from Increased Grid Access Charge Request a ‘Positive Step’

Renewable Energy World: Arizona Public Service’s (APS) recent offer to the Arizona Corporation Commission (ACC) to forgo a request for an interim increase to the utility’s distributed generation grid access charge is a “step in a positive direction,” a spokesperson for home solar provider Sunrun said on Sept. 28.

In a Sept. 25 filing to the ACC, the utility asked the ACC to move forward with “cost of service” hearings to ensure future electricity rates are fair to all customers.
